Descrizione
Set against the backdrop of the arid and inhospitable planet Arrakis, Herbert's trilogy intricately weaves tales of power, survival, and the transformative journey of humanity. The desert world, rich in a valuable substance known as spice, becomes the center of a fierce and tumultuous struggle for control, drawing factions and factions into a web of intrigue and conflict. As the desert unfolds its secrets, the inhabitants of Arrakis must navigate their destinies amid the looming shadows of political machinations and ecological challenges.
At the heart of these narratives are the characters who rise from the harsh sands to challenge fate. Their struggles reflect profound themes of prophecy, leadership, and the complexity of loyalty in a world where betrayal lingers just a breath away. Each character is intricately crafted, revealing depths of ambition, fear, and hope that resonate with the universal human experience.
Herbert's masterful prose enlivens landscapes filled with colossal dunes, treacherous sands, and the very essence of life itself. The trilogy invites readers to explore philosophical questions regarding the intersection of humanity, technology, and the environment, making it a timeless saga that continues to captivate generations.
